Confluence のサーバー ID を変更する方法
目的
Confluence のテスト インストレーションで使用するための新しいサーバー ID を取得します。これは必須の作業ではないことにご注意ください。テスト サーバーが本番環境と同じサーバー ID を保持していても、本番環境への影響はありません。しかしながら、別のサーバー ID の使用は、サポート チームでのお客様のサーバーの識別に役立ちます。
If you're having trouble setting up an Application Link because of duplicated server IDs, please refer to How to create a cloned Confluence instance with a new server ID and application ID instead.
Or, if your Server ID is missing, please refer to Server ID Shows as $action.serverId, $action.sid or n.v. for how to insert it.
ソリューション
テスト インストレーションのサーバー ID を変えたい場合、テスト環境用に新しいサーバー ID を取得する必要があります。
- Confluence の新しい一時インスタンスをインストールします。「Confluence のインストール」をご参照ください。
- zip ファイルを選択します。自動インストーラーは使用しないでください。
- インストレーションが新しい空のホーム ディレクトリを指していることを確認します。
新しい一時 Confluence インスタンスを起動します。これにより、指定したホーム ディレクトリに
confluence.cfg.xml
が作成されます。ファイルで次の行を見つけます。<property name="confluence.setup.server.id">BIBE-YA0Z-8EK6-SS9C</property>
ご自身のファイルの上述の行に、使用可能なサーバー ID が含まれます。
- テスト サーバーで
<<Confluence-Home>>/confluence.cfg.xml file
に移動し、既存のサーバー ID を、Confluence の新しい一時インスタンスで取得したもので置き換えます。 データベースでサーバー ID を確認します。
select * from BANDANA where bandanakey = 'confluence.server.id';
And update it if it is not correct (use your own value):
update BANDANA set bandanavalue = '<string>BIBE-YA0Z-8EK6-SS9C</string>' where bandanakey = 'confluence.server.id';
- Start up the test server, go to Administration --> License Details and update the license to your developer license that you generated from https://my.atlassian.com.